Output cabcfbd1c673d2af96b40385e3a79c3ad76ca9d359667960efcd0ac36cb4ef8f:1

value
649933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ae76518871b20859eb79fe0c896d784d673cc173 OP_EQUAL
address
3HbVEqNxftuuiEfCBF5Z7Xddiwg5556iT3
transaction
cabcfbd1c673d2af96b40385e3a79c3ad76ca9d359667960efcd0ac36cb4ef8f
confirmations
367388
spent
true